客户端7.0

角标:

 

客户端V7.0 角标的展示方法

角标注释 
<#-- f_cornerShowType【角标展示】复选框,非必填,1:免费;2:限免;3:会员;4:完本;5:名家;6:上传;  -->

角标获取 
<#assign f_cornerShowType = f_value.getValue("f_cornerShowType")!""> 

角标方法的定义
<#-- --------------展示角标的方法-------------- -->
<#-- 优先级 上传>限免>名家>会员>免费>完本 -->
<#macro showCorner(book)>
 <#assign isUgc = book.isUgc()!""><#-- 这本书是否是上传的 -->
 <#assign timeInfo = book.getTimeFreeInfo("0")!"">
 <#if timeInfo?? && timeInfo!="">
 <#assign timeResult = timeInfo.getAdapterResult()!"">
 <#assign timeType = timeInfo.getActivityType()!"">
 <#else>
 <#assign timeResult = "">
 <#assign timeType = "">
 </#if>
 <#if timeInfo?? && timeResult=="0" && timeType=="5"><#-- 这本书是否限免 -->
 <#assign isTimeFree = "true">
 <#else> 
 <#assign isTimeFree = "false">
 </#if>
 <#assign isFamous = (book.getAuthor().isFamous())!""><#-- 这本书是否名家 0:否;1:是;-->
 <#assign bookNode = (book.getNode().getId())!"">
 <!-- bookNode:${bookNode}-->
 <#if bookNode!="" && bookNode!="590001121">
 <#assign isMember ="true">
 <#else>
 <#assign isMember = "false">
 </#if>
 <#assign bookLevel = book.getBookLevel()!""><#-- 这本书是否免费 1:一级图书,即免费;-->
 <#assign bookStatus = book.getStatus()!""><#-- 获取图书状态 0:连载;1:完本; -->
 <#if f_cornerShowType?contains("6") && isUgc><#-- 上传 -->
 <i class="cmr-booktag-ugc"></i>
 <#elseif f_cornerShowType?contains("2") && isTimeFree=="true"><#-- 限免 -->
 <i class="cmr-booktag-limitfree"></i>
 <#elseif f_cornerShowType?contains("5") && isFamous=="1"><#-- 名家 -->
 <i class="cmr-booktag-famous"></i>
 <#elseif f_cornerShowType?contains("3") && isMember=="true" ><#-- 会员 -->
 <i class="cmr-booktag-member"></i>
 <#elseif f_cornerShowType?contains("1") && bookLevel=="1"><#-- 免费 -->
 <i class="cmr-booktag-free"></i>
 <#elseif f_cornerShowType?contains("4") && bookStatus=="1"><#-- 完本 -->
 <i class="cmr-booktag-finish"></i>
 </#if>
</#macro> 

角标方法的调用
<#call showCorner(book)> 

目前要加角标的碎片
多图混排V7;横向内容列表V7;纵向内容展示列表V7

 

转载于:https://www.cnblogs.com/wuhairui/articles/6742115.html

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值